#ec7584 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ec7584 is composed of 92.5% red, 45.9%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.4% magenta, 44.1%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 352.4 degrees, a saturation of 75.8% and a lightness of 69.2%. #ec7584 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ffeaff with #d90009.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

Shades and Tints of #ec7584

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110204 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#ec7584

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6abad is the less saturated color, while #fe6376 is the most saturated one.
